FCA launches IAAT

The UK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) has launched the investment advice assessment tool (IAAT) to help personal investment firms assess the suitability of their investment advice and disclosures to consumers (excluding advice on retirement income or defined benefit transfer advice). The IAAT offers a structured methodology for reviewing past advice provided since 3 January 2018, including in response to business complaints or as part of a past business review. The tool is intended not only for the use of investment firms but also professional indemnity insurance providers, compliance or legal consultants and trustees of defined contribution pension schemes. Use of the IAAT is subject to the FCA's licensing agreement, which must be reviewed before access or use. To support firms, the FCA has also published an instruction guide explaining how to use the IAAT and interpret the results of file reviews conducted by the FCA.
